Spider Solitaire is a solitaire game where the objective is to order all the cards in descending runs from King down to Ace in the same suit. Spider Solitaire on Solitaire Network has been modified to be brought into line with the standard rules of Spider as are common in many other solitaire packages. A full set of King through Ace in the same suit is 13 points. For example, if a Column has a K, Q, and J of the same suit in sequence then three points are scored for that combination. One point is scored for each card built within a Column starting with a King. You aim to create sequences from King to Ace, ultimately. All Columns must contain a card before more cards can be dealt from the Stock. The objective is to arrange cards in eight tableau columns, building down in descending order by suit. When a sequence of King through Ace in the same suit is formed within a Column, it is removed from the layout.Įmpty Columns may be filled with any card or movable sequence of cards. For example, in a sequence of 8, 7, 6 of Spades, the 7 and 6 may be split apart from the 8 in order to be played to another 8. Sequences may be split apart once formed. However, an 8 of clubs, 7 and 6 of Spades may not move as a unit because they are not all of the same suit. For example, an 8, 7, and 6 of Spades may move to any 9. Also, cards of the same suit and in sequence may be moved to another Column provided the above build rule applies. 'For the Damaged Coda' is a song by indie rock band Blonde Redhead which came to prominence after it was used in an episode of Rick and Morty as the theme for the 'Evil Morty' character. It became much more popular after it was used in the Season 3 episode "Tales From the Citadel," which aired September 10th, 2017 (shown below, right). 'For the Damaged Coda' is taken from the fifth studio album by Blonde Redhead, 'Melody of Certain Damaged Lemons', released on June 6, 2000.Website: http://. The music that appears in the award-winning series 'Rick and Morty' as the theme for Evil Morty (most prominently during the credits of Season 1, Episode 10: 'Close Rick-counters of the Rick Kind') is a song by the American band Blonde Redhead called 'For the Damaged Coda'. ![]() The episode aired April 7th, 2014 (shown below, left). It is featured at the end of the episodes " Close Rick-counters of the Rick Kind," played while Evil Morty destroys his eye-patch transmitter, and " The Ricklantis Mixup" played after Evil Morty is revealed to be the new president of The Citadel.īlonde Redhead later created a remixed version for Rick and Morty called More Coda, which plays during " Rickmurai Jack" when Evil Morty breaks open the Central Finite Curve and escapes into the rest of the multiverse. Graphical AbstractĬatalysis is a key and emergent concept in chemistry: substances are assigned a special role as they take part in a reaction but are eventually recovered unchanged after a product has been formed. We then elaborate on the specific conceptual issues that arise in the context of autonomous computational procedures, some of which we discuss at an example catalytic system. In this work, we first review the state of the art in computational catalysis to embed autonomous explorations into the general field from which it draws its ingredients. This allows for a high fidelity of the formalization of some catalytic process and for surprising in silico discoveries.
